1. Deep Learning-Based Cryptanalysis of a Simplified AES Cipher
- Author
-
Hicham Grari, Khalid Zine-Dine, Ahmed Azouaoui, and Siham Lamzabi
- Subjects
Information Systems - Abstract
Recently, Deep Neural Networks have shown great deal of reliability and applicability as its applications spread in different areas. This paper proposes a cryptanalysis model based on Deep Neural Network, the neural network takes in plaintexts and their corresponding ciphertexts to predict the secret key of the cipher. We proposes two different approaches, in the first we use multi-layer perceptron (MLP). While in the second, the cryptanalysis problem is modeled as a multi-label classification problem, we introduce appropriate Deep Neural Network based methods for tackling such problem. We illustrate the effectiveness of the approach of the DNN-based cryptanalysis by attacking on Simplified AES block cipher. Therefore, specific metrics are readapted to the cryptanalysis context and used to evaluate the proposed schemes. The results indicate that treating cryptanalysis problem as multi-label classification is more suitable and can be a useful and promising tool for the cryptanalysis task.
- Published
- 2022
- Full Text
- View/download PDF